Petrol station altercationIntoxicated man arrested after insulting police

A man who was reportedly under the combined effects of heat and alcohol was arrested following an altercation at a petrol station.

According to the police, a fight was reported to them on Wednesday afternoon at a petrol station on Rue Denis Netgen in Schifflange, in which a man involved had been injured. At the scene, officers and the emergency services found three people and a damaged car.

One of the individuals was clearly intoxicated. The uncooperative man, who insulted the police officers and, due to his condition, was a danger to himself and others, was taken into custody. He was also reported for insulting an officer.

Licence confiscated in Diekirch

Police also reported that a woman was stopped by police in Diekirch on Thursday night after being reported earlier at Place Guillaume. After failing a breathalyser test, her driving licence was confiscated.
